The advancement in automation and sensory systems in recent years has led to an increase the demand of UAV missions. Due to this increase in demand, the research community has gained interest in investigating UAV performance enhancing systems. Circulation Control (CC), which is an active control flow method used to enhance UAV lift, is a performance enhancing system currently studied. In prior research, experimental studies have shown that Circulation Control wings (CCW) implemented on class-I UAVs can reduce take-off distance by 54%.
